Overview

The conference will bring together over 450 scientists and engineers from around the world who will attend 42 invited talks, 222 oral contributed talks, and 262 poster presentations. The GEC program includes four workshops on Monday, an opening reception on Monday evening, and a Thursday evening awards banquet. In addition, an industry exhibition will take place along the conference. The GEC prides itself in student attendance. The conference will present the "Student Award for Excellence" to the best student oral presentation, selected from a group of 4 finalists.

Session numbering scheme

Each session code consists of a letter and a number. The first letter indicates the number of that session in the program, e.g. A for 1, B for 2 etc. The second letter indicates the day of the week: M for Monday, T for Tuesday, W for Wednesday, R for Thursday, and F for Friday. The last number (1-4) is the index used to distinguish the concurrent sessions (see table below for room assignments). The plenary session on Wednesday will take place in the Auditorium Maximum (Audimax), and the poster sessions will be held in the Audimax (Foyer).

Session index --> Room
1 --> room 1
2 --> room 2a
3 --> room 2b
4 --> room 3

Presentation format

Papers that have been accepted for presentations are listed in the scientific program. Invited talks are allotted 25 minutes, with 5 additional minutes for questions and discussion. Oral contributed talks are allotted 12 minutes, with 3 additional minutes for questions and discussion. Poster boards in Audimax will contain two posters on each side, each poster with a size of 84,1 x 118,9 cm (size DinA0). The posters may remain on display throughout the day and have to be removed at the close of each day (Tuesday and Wednesday evenings by 8:00 pm).
